Ozzy Osborne, former singer of Black Sabbath before being kicked out and going solo. This is one of his most famous songs. It's about the Cold War between the US and the USSR. Randy Rhoads, not seen here was the guitarist on the studio version and one of the best guitarists ever. Randy Rhoads was on the first two Ozzy albums before his life was cut short by a plane crash. This concert had a lot of bands for 3 days over Memorial Weekend in 1983. It was between 90 - 100 degrees all 3 days. Each day was a different genre. Saturday was New Wave Day. Sunday was Heavy Metal day. Monday was general rock day. It was held at an open area in Southern CA. It was like a modern day Woodstock. Put on by Steve Wozniak who is Apple computer co-founder. Because it was so successful, an actual venue now called Glen Helen music venue in Devore CA. I live close to downtown Los Angeles and it's a 2 hour drive from my house. I saw No Doubt there in 2004.
